The best residential markets for single-income households

While Canadian residential property prices have trended upward in recent years, home ownership on a single income is still very much within the realm of possibility, according to the latest report from real estate portal Zoocasa.


In its most recent study, Zoocasa calculated the home-price-to-income ratio – that is, the indicator of how long it would take an owner to fully pay off their home if they contributed 100% of their annual income to shelter costs – in Canada’s major markets.


Data was culled from February numbers provided by the Canadian Real Estate Board and the median household income from Statistics Canada. A higher ratio means a longer payment timeline.

The 5 Most Affordable Home Markets

  • Rank 5: Saguenay Home-price-to-income ratio: 6 Average home price: $161,587 Median one-person income: $29,125

  • Rank 4: Fredericton Home-price-to-income ratio: 5 Average home price: $179,981 Median one-person income: $34,724

  • Rank 3: Trois Riviers Home-price-to-income ratio: 4 Average home price: $153,591 Median one-person income: $34,745

  • Rank 2: Greater Moncton Home-price-to-income ratio: 4 Average home price: $174,800 Median one-person income: $39,456

  • Rank 1: Saint John Home-price-to-income ratio: 4 Average home price: $171,596 Median one-person income: $39,163

The 5 Least Affordable Home Markets


  • Rank 5: Victoria Home-price-to-income ratio: 17 Average home price: $5642,800 Median one-person income: $37,793

  • Rank 4: Okanagan Mainline Home-price-to-income ratio: 18 Average home price: $509,545 Median one-person income: $28,900

  • Rank 3: Greater Toronto Home-price-to-income ratio: 19 Average home price: $751,700 Median one-person income: $39,560

  • Rank 2: Fraser Valley Home-price-to-income ratio: 25 Average home price: $795,100 Median one-person income: $31,568

  • Rank 1: Greater Vancouver Home-price-to-income ratio: 28 Average home price: $1,071,800 Median one-person income: $38,164
